但是不要进行任何commit操作,或者会结束后续的cherry-pick过程,如果进行commit操作,则提交内容直接应用到当前分支了。 6.解决所有冲突后,继续完成cherry-pick过程: λ git cherry-pick --continue 7.如果在解决冲突后决定不再应用此补丁,可以取消cherry-pick操作: git cherry-pick --abort 通过以上步骤,你成功地将单...
git cherry-pick可以选择某一个分支中的一个或几个commit(s)来进行操作(操作的对象是commit)。 1、使用方法&需求 场景: 假设我们有个稳定版本的分支,叫v2.0,另外还有个开发版本的分支v3.0,我们不能直接把两个分支合并,这样会导致稳定版本混乱,但是又想增加一个v3.0中的功能到v2.0中,这里就可以使用cherry-pick...
mark the corrected paths hint: with 'git add <paths>' or 'git rm <paths>' hint: and commit the result with 'git commit' //...省略掉中间处理冲突的事项 $ git log --oneline --graph * e08bab6 (HEAD -> dev) cherry-pick a3 * 2da150a ...
2.git cherry-pick– 挑拣特定的提交. 你需要从另一个分支只取一个提交变更,但不想把所有内容都合并进来。git cherry-pick只会将你需要的提交变更带进来。 它做了什么:让你将某个分支上的特定代码提交应用到另一个分支上。 什么时候用: 你得从另一个分支获得一个 bug 修复,而不需要合并那些不必要的改动。
λ git log --graph --oneline * 55b234d (HEAD -> develop) 修改文案 * c8b94bb (origin/develop) 文件冲突修改 |\ | * 79f1d47 修改远程地址 * | 244769e 修改 |/ ... 如果在应用更改时出现冲突,Git会暂停cherry-pick过程并提示你解决冲突。
GIT 的merge、rebase和cherry-pick区别和使用示例 名词解释 就是大体说一下git的上传和撤销的工作流程,用图解Git (marklodato.github.io)的一张图就能说的很明白了 或者看这张图 当前环境 有两个分支一个是master,另一个是dev,两个分支都指向同一个提交,并且两个分支的状态都是干净的。
Would really like to use the graph view to perform bulk-operations, such as cherry-picking 🙏 👍1 Activity bpaseroassigned lszomoruon Sep 27, 2024 lszomoruadded scmGeneral SCM compound issues feature-requestRequest for new features or functionality on Sep 27, 2024 lszomoruadded this to ...
gitlab 对比两个分支graph gitlab 比较两次提交的区别 Git的各种操作 commit信息的比较 git diff id_1 id_2 git cherry-pick git diff 的用法 其他知识请参考 git中实现提交信息的换行,以及撤销换行的操作 换行 撤销换行操作 ctrl+c 中断commit操作 git commit --amend -m 重新修改...
git cherry-pick<commit-hash> 提示: 当您需要反向移植错误修复或小功能时,这尤其有用。 8. 清理本地分支 一旦您完成了某个功能,就不要让旧分支残留。使用这个简单的命令清理它们。 如何使用它: git branch -d<branch-name> 提示: 如果您需要强...
如果操作的commit是一次合并记录的话,此次的commit是有2个父节点的,需要用户指明,cherry-pick哪一个父节点。这样做,会丢失掉这次合并的记录。 我的处理方法是,直接忽略这次的commit,不进行cherrypick The way a cherry-pick works is by taking the diff a changeset represents (the difference between the working...